Hooking 360 to a 1600 x 900 Monitor

Frosty the Snow PlowFrosty the Snow Plow Registered User regular
My google-fu isn't serving me well today.

My old CRT TV gave out today and since all I ever used it for was gaming, I decided to see about hooking up a nice PC monitor I had laying around. I understand that I'll need two adaptors, one for the 360 -> Monitor, and one for the audio jacks to a 3.5mm stereo female, but I'm not particularly literate about these things.

For getting a 1600 x 900 monitor to work well, would VGA or HDMI-to-DVI be better? Since the resolution itself isn't exactly supported, how close can I get? If not streched, will the letterboxing be particularly bad?

Any help would be rad. I'm only vaguely knowledgeable about any of this.

    The 360 should autoselect the proper resolution.

    Mine always did when I switched it to a non 1080/720 standard resolution monitor.

    Worst case go into the system settings and choose a resolution that is the same aspect ratio as your monitor.
